Holistic reforms being introduced in health, education, says Punjab CM

By Our Correspondent
January 06, 2020

LAHORE: Chief Minister Sardar Usman Buzdar has said that bringing ease in the lives of the people is a real social revolution and added that holistic reforms are being introduced in health, education, agriculture and other sectors.

Now, development is not limited to a few major cities like the past but its scope has been expanded to small all the cities and localities so that everyone could equally benefit from it. Resources are not meant for some specific cities now, said the chief minister in a statement issued here Sunday.

Usman Buzdar said the government was fully committed to improving the lot of the people living in remote areas. He regretted that some unscrupulous elements were afraid of change. Regrettably, the outdated system has given nothing to the people. There is no room for corrupt elements or any corruption in the new Pakistan, he added. New Pakistan will be made under the leadership of Prime Minister Imran Khan and every possible facility will be available to the people. Those who are making hue and cry will be left behind and the new Pakistan, led by Imran Khan, will move towards progress. He said that Pakistan is moving forward to achieve the goal of development and several steps have been taken by the PTI-led government for public welfare.

He pointed out that government expenditures had been curtailed through a culture of austerity and simplicity while resources were wasted in the past on exhibitory projects. The PTI government has discontinued the wrong practice of using resources because public money is a trust of the people and it is being used for public welfare now, he said.
